When providing the house
number portion of the address,
the system recognizes both digit
format and numerical text. An
example would be to say,
3-0-0-0-1 or Thirty
Thousand One.
If the system provides
destination in another country on
several attempts, say the
Change Country command and
say the country of interest. The
country default is the United
States. To enter a destination in
Canada or Mexico, the country
will first have to be changed in
the system.
